Just back from a very relaxing and enjoyable week at Eleana Apartments in Ireon. We flew from Athens after a few hectic days there - the flight is short and easy, and Ireon is only a few minutes drive from the airport at Pythagorion (although the small number of flights means that there is no disturbance from air traffic during your stay). Our apartment was big, and was of the highest quality for the type that I've encountered so far in Greece - basic but had everything you would need, and some nice personal touches in the decor. It was also spotlessly clean, and was maintained this way for the duration of our stay.
Ireon is small, but has plenty in the way of restaurants and bars, and everywhere seems very friendly. There is a beach in the town, and another about 1km away (Pappas Beach) which makes a lovely walk and pretty destination. There are nice walks inland too, for example to the village of Mili about 3.5km away, giving great views over Ireon and the coast on the way there (although sadly no photographic opportunities at this stage of the walk, as there is a military base in the vicinity). The archeological site of the Temple of Hera is also in easy walking distance.
It would be well worth hiring a car to see other places on the island, but there is plenty to keep you occupied in Ireon and its environs.
